Destination Guide

The Maldives is a tropical paradise known for its white sandy beaches, crystal-clear waters, and vibrant marine life. Job opportunities are primarily in the tourism and hospitality sectors, with roles in resorts, diving, and water sports. The culture is a blend of South Asian, African, and Arab influences, with a strong emphasis on community and hospitality. The lifestyle is relaxed, with a focus on outdoor activities and water-based recreation. For relocation, a work visa is required, typically arranged by the employer. The cost of living can be high, but many employers provide accommodation and meals. English is widely spoken, making it easier for expatriates to adapt.
